Anthropic's Claude develops emergent internal 'J-space' for thinking

Anthropic's Claude model has developed an internal "J-space" where it can process concepts without externalizing them. This emergent capability allows Claude to think about ideas internally, a feature not explicitly programmed by its creators. Researchers are exploring this phenomenon to understand advanced AI cognition. AI
